Here’s where it gets real: The technical differences in detail

Scudo

Costs and Efficiency:

Looking at overall running costs, both models reveal some interesting differences in everyday economy.

Fiat Scudo is slightly cheaper – starting at 30,900 £ , while the Ford Explorer EV costs 34,200 £ . That’s a price difference of around 3,294 £.

In terms of energy consumption, the Ford Explorer EV is considerably more efficient: consuming 14.6 kWh/100km compared to 23.6 kWh/100km for the Fiat Scudo. That’s a difference of about 9 kWh/100km.

As for electric range, the Ford Explorer EV offers significantly more range – reaching up to 602 km, about 250 km more than the Fiat Scudo.

Explorer EV

Engine and Performance:

Under the bonnet, it becomes clear which model is tuned for sportiness and which one takes the lead when you hit the accelerator.

When it comes to engine power, the Ford Explorer EV offers significantly more power – delivering 340 HP compared to 180 HP. That’s roughly 160 HP more horsepower.

When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the Ford Explorer EV is considerably quicker – completing the sprint in 5.3 s, while the Fiat Scudo takes 10.5 s. That’s about 5.2 s quicker.

There’s also a difference in torque: the Ford Explorer EV delivers clearly more torque with 679 Nm compared to 400 Nm. That’s about 279 Nm more.

Space and Everyday Use:

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.

Seats: Fiat Scudo offers more seats – 8 vs 5.

In terms of curb weight, Fiat Scudo is a bit lighter – 1,722 kg compared to 1,996 kg. The difference is around 274 kg.

Looking at boot space, the Fiat Scudo offers significantly more boot space – 800 L compared to 472 L. That’s a difference of about 328 L.

When it comes to payload, the Fiat Scudo carries substantially more – 1,805 kg compared to 585 kg. That’s a difference of about 1,220 kg.
